Ray-Ban Meta Gen 2 Glasses Get $70 Off Amid AI-Powered Handy Features

New York Post reviews Ray-Ban Meta Gen 2 smart glasses, praising Meta AI for hands-free questions, translation and reminders, and noting an Amazon deal that cuts the price by $70 (from $459 to $390.15). The glasses boast a 12MP ultra-wide camera, 3K video, five-mic audio, up to 8 hours of battery (48 hours with the charging case), and come in a variety of frames and lens options.

Govee’s portable lamp goes on first-time sale at Amazon

Govee has put its portable Table Lamp Classic on sale for the first time at Amazon for $63.99 ($16 off), a cheaper yet brighter alternative to Philips Hue Go with a 4,800mAh battery lasting up to 30 hours with color lighting (about 5 hours in bright white), up to 500 lumens, 2700K–6500K color temps, music-sync and mood presets, app-based lighting prompts, and Matter support—though it lacks the Hue Go’s IP54 weather resistance.

DJI Mic 3 Bundle Slashed to $259, Powers the Osmo Ecosystem

Amazon cuts the DJI Mic 3 wireless bundle by 21% to $259, including two TX units, one RX, a charging case and USB-C adapter. The setup sells on long battery life (TX ~8h, RX ~10h, charging case up to 28h) with three voice styles and two noise-cancellation modes, and it remains broadly compatible with Osmo devices even without a receiver, making it a strong deal for video creators.

DJI Power 1000 V2 Drops to $429 in Presidents’ Day Power Deal

DJI’s Power 1000 V2 portable power station is discounted to $429 on Amazon (39% off from $699) during Presidents’ Day, offering 1,024Wh of capacity, quiet operation (as low as 26 dB), and fast recharging—80% in 37 minutes and 100% in 56 minutes—with dual USB-C ports for quick DJI drone battery charging. Weighing about 31 pounds, it can be expanded with up to five DJI Expansion Battery 2000 units (each adding 2,048Wh) for even more power, making it a strong option for content creators and off-grid use.

DJI Mini 5 Pro Fly More Combo Drops to $1,099 on Amazon

Amazon is offering the DJI Mini 5 Pro Fly More Combo for $1,099, a $500 (31%) discount from $1,599 and a new record low. The bundle includes the drone, RC 2 remote, filters, three batteries, three propeller sets, and a shoulder bag. The Mini 5 Pro features a 1-inch CMOS sensor with 4K HDR at 60fps (and 4K 120fps), Nightscape omnidirectional sensing and nighttime return-to-home, plus ActiveTrack 360° for moving subjects. Despite the FCC ban on foreign drones, existing stock in the U.S. remains legal to own, but deals may disappear as inventory dwindles.
